Transaction 74c8356a2dbf057f11ed5c82159bda8a5db743196f649943caf08c0e87058f37
1 Input
1 Output
-
74c8356a2dbf057f11ed5c82159bda8a5db743196f649943caf08c0e87058f37:0
- value
- 615342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eaed36d3dd1fbda124995641f82e1def3a42239e OP_EQUAL
- address
- 3P7CDMvaVw5gzM6jrjBoCEUzSiqrfg979q